• A bill (HB 1444) that would have ended the state’s vehicle safety inspection program has been dropped from the Missouri House of Representatives calendar. The Automotive Service Association (ASA) and AASA opposed the proposed legislation, which never received a floor vote.

• Jiffy Lube International has recognized Team Lucor as its “Franchisee of the Year.” Lucor has 158 Jiffy Lube shops in North Carolina, Georgia, Tennessee, Virginia, Ohio and Pennsylvania.
• Tint World Automotive Styling Centers (Boca Raton, FL) has six franchise locations set to open this summer in Arizona, Delaware, California, Michigan, Tennessee, and Texas, which will increase the total number of Tint World franchises to more than 60 locations. Additionally, a new Tint World location is poised to open in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ates this month.
• The Safelite Group, the Columbus, OH-based vehicle glass services company, has reached an agreement to acquire the assets of Richardson Auto Glass, which has shops in Texas and Louisiana.
